大尺度蒸发模型研究
引用本文:黄贤庆,刘新仁.大尺度蒸发模型研究[J].河海大学学报(自然科学版),2000,28(4):13-18.
作者姓名:黄贤庆  刘新仁
作者单位:河海大学水文水资源及环境学院,江苏,南京,210098
基金项目:国家自然科学基金,49794030,
摘    要:选用淮河流域及其周边的10个气象站的35年气象资料和29个蒸发站的35个月蒸发资料作分析,同时对Dalton公式、Penman公式作了简化,进而提出了具有较为明确的物理基础的淮河流域分区蒸发模型,该模型可用于大尺度水文模型中的蒸散发能力估算。

关 键 词:月蒸发  大尺度  线性回归  非线性估计

Study on Large Scale Evaporation Modeling
HUANG Xian qing,LIU Xin ren.Study on Large Scale Evaporation Modeling[J].Journal of Hohai University (Natural Sciences ),2000,28(4):13-18.
Authors:HUANG Xian qing  LIU Xin ren
Abstract:In many conventional hydrological models,potential evaporation is estimated by pan evaporation. However, this method is not suitable for large scale modeling. So a study is made in depth to simulate potential evaporation. A 35 years series of monthly data of ten weather stations and twenty nine evaporation stations in and nearby the Huaihe basin are selected for analysis, which shows a regional distribution regularity and correlation between monthly evaporation and seven meteorological factors significantly. Based on the recommendation and comparison of several models, a simplified method to estimate potential evaporation is proposed and the method is suggested to be applied to the Huaihe basin modeling in HUBEX.
Keywords:monthly evaporation  large scale  linear regression  nonlinear estimation
